Reverse pitch fan with divided splitter [PDF]
A guide vane arrangement is described for improving gas turbine performance in the reverse thrust mode. This flow straightening method produces low losses in the fluid entering a core engine during reverse thrust operations and allows large supercharging

Unleashing the Power of Machine Learning in Nanomedicine Formulation Development
A random forest machine learning model is able to make predictions on nanoparticle attributes of different nanomedicines (i.e. lipid nanoparticles, liposomes, or PLGA nanoparticles) based on microfluidic formulation parameters. Machine learning models are based on a database of nanoparticle formulations, and models are able to generate unique solutions

Time-optimal Earth–Mars transfer using nuclear electric propulsion
This study focuses on the time-optimal end-to-end transfer trajectory between Earth and Mars using a low-thrust nuclear electric propulsion (NEP) system.

Configurations and Key Issues of Low Thrust Measurement for Microspacecrafts
Microthrusters on microspacecrafts are of interest and its output thrust must be characterized for a particular applicaton. The technology of micro thrust measurement can evaluate the performance of microthrusters.

Thrust Measurement of an Integrated Multi-Sensor Micro-Newton Cold Gas Thruster
In recent years, cold gas thrusters have been successfully deployed in numerous missions, showcasing their exceptional reliability and enabling ultra-precise space operations across a broad thrust range.
